Well I just brewed myself a fresh cup of coffee and figured a little update would be good. Today I wanted to share the progress the EK 860+ waterblock for the GTX 770 (Yes, the 680 block is suggested by EK for the 770). Already I'm a bit frustrated by not taking enough pictures that have good lighting and focus (I'm building a controlled light booth in my basement and looking at some used DSLRs).

Installing the water block was fairly straight forward. EK provides great documentation with pictures to follow. The only issue I saw was from overtightening the back plate, it started to warp the pcb so I just loosened the screws until the pcb was flat.
